North West Primary Care Mental Health Team

Primary Care Mental Health Teams (PCMHT)  aim to provide information and support to enable people to work through emotional health difficulties that they may have, and to improve their overall health and wellbeing. The service is suitable for adults  with mild to moderate mental health problems. The sevive helps those experiencing common mental health problems …

ENABLE Scotland

ENABLE Scotland is a dynamic charity run by its members. They are a service provider offering a wide range of person centred services designed to ensure that people who have learning disabilities can live the life they want and actively participate in their community. Contact the Elderly

Supported by a network of volunteers, the charity organises monthly Sunday afternoon tea parties for small groups of older people, aged 75 and over, who live alone. Offering a regular and vital friendship link every month. Each older person is collected from their home by a volunteer driver and taken to a volunteer host’s home …

Saneline

SANE runs a national, out-of-hours mental health helpline offering specialist emotional support and information to anyone affected by mental illness, including family, friends and carers. They are open every day of the year from 4:30pm to 10:30pm.
